Ranunculus and anemones are two of our absolute favorite spring blooms! They can be intimidating and require some extra steps to be rewarded with their fluffy goodness. Join us as we walk you through the first step we take in successfully growing these spring beauties. We need to wake 'em up by plumping 'em up! Plus while we're at it, we're going to show you how to DIY corm soaking system that can also be used for brewing a homemade batch of compost tea!

Is it possible to keep ranunculus and anemones in their pots after summer blooms. I will keep them dry inside but not out of the pot for next spring. Please is anyone know? Thanks.
@sierraflowerfarm
@sierraflowerfarm 3 жыл бұрын
Hi Lina! You’ll want to let the foliage die back and yellow before cutting it back. I prefer to lift, divide and wash but you can leave it in the pot, they will dehydrate but that’s okay- you’ll just need to wake them up again which you can do without pre-soaking too. Let us know how it goes! Happy growing!

I read your article on your website but still have a question. After soaking, how long do you pre-sprout for? I know you said it takes 1 week for roots to start growing. I was thinking of sprouting them for about 4 weeks before my planting date, is this too long? I don't want to have to screw around with potting them up if I start them too early.
@sierraflowerfarm
@sierraflowerfarm 3 жыл бұрын
Hi Levi! Thank you for reaching out! It should take the roots about one week to begin sprouting, it can take longer if they are pre-sprouting in colder temperatures. I would say four weeks is a good window for not having to fuss with potting them up (I hear ya!) . I usually like to plant the corms when their roots are at least an inch long. We do have a blog about pre-sprouting the corms and towards the end, you can just scroll to the section about what to do if you are delayed in planting them out. In a nutshell, if your corms are growing too fast for your planting out schedule put them in cooler temperatures, around 37F or so and that should slow them down.
